Marshawn Lynch’s transition from the football field to the screen is a compelling narrative of reinvention. After a successful NFL career marked by aggressive running and unmatched physicality, Lynch is now venturing into the world of acting. His role in Euphoria represents a significant step forward, offering him a platform to explore a more complex side of performance.
Lynch, nicknamed "Beast Mode," made a name for himself with the Buffalo Bills and later the Seattle Seahawks, where he played a crucial role in their Super Bowl XLVIII victory. Off the field, he has maintained a private life but has gradually embraced opportunities in entertainment, with appearances in series like Brooklyn Nine-Nine and Westworld.
In Euphoria Season 3, Lynch will be part of Zendaya’s plot line. The show, known for its layered characters and bold narratives, provides him with a platform to showcase his acting abilities. Lynch has expressed genuine enthusiasm for the project, emphasizing his excitement about collaborating with the cast and crew.
The addition of Lynch, alongside names like Natasha Lyonne, Rosalía, and Sharon Stone, suggests that Season 3 will expand its narrative scope while retaining its signature intensity.
